2 dépôts
Practices for using structured comments to explain the intent and limitations of styles.
Distinguishing note: The candidates focus on document output or generators, not the act of documenting CSS code itself.
Explore 2 awesome GitHub repositories matching user interface & experience · CSS Code Documentation. Refine with filters or upvote what's useful.
Idiomatic CSS is a CSS style guide and architecture standard designed to ensure the creation of consistent and maintainable styles. It provides a set of standardized rules and conventions for writing idiomatic CSS code, functioning as both a formatting specification and a general guide for style organization. The project focuses on CSS preprocessor best practices, specifically providing guidelines to manage nesting depth and selector specificity to avoid complex cascades. It further distinguishes itself through structured documentation patterns and component sectioning to improve the long-ter
Provides structured commenting and sectioning patterns to explain the purpose and limitations of style components.
KSS est un outil de documentation de composants CSS et un générateur de guide de style. Il mappe les règles CSS aux éléments visuels en extrayant la documentation et les règles de style directement des feuilles de style pour créer une référence visuelle pour les composants UI. Le système utilise un système de numérotation hiérarchique et une taxonomie numérique pour organiser les styles et définir les relations structurelles entre les composants. Il analyse des motifs spécifiques dans les commentaires CSS pour extraire des métadonnées, y compris les descriptions, les états de modificateur et les définitions de paramètres pour les mixins et les fonctions. L'outil couvre l'analyse et l'extraction CSS pour maintenir la documentation du système de design. Ce processus transforme les métadonnées extraites en références visuelles rendues en utilisant la génération basée sur des modèles et le mappage d'éléments UI.
Supports the practice of using structured comments within stylesheets to describe components, mixins, and compatibility.